## Deploying the Gatewick Proctor Queue

Deploys are pretty painless: push to main, wait for the pipeline, then watch the queue drain dashboard for five minutes. If candidates pile up mid-exam, roll back first and ask questions later — the queue replays safely. Everything the workers care about lives in one config block, shown here for reference.

settings of bafof-yagef:
JOROX_PIN=8740
JOROX_TENANT=pelox
JOROX_METRICS_HOST=metrics.jorox.qorvelworks.internal
JOROX_SEAL=seal_c78f63c1
JOROX_STANDBY_TEAM=norax

**Ticket: Drift in cold-storage archiver config**

Plugin authors: we detected configuration drift between the Hollowmere archiver's declared settings and what runs in production. Buckets older than the retention threshold were archived with mismatched compression flags, which may affect plugins reading archive manifests. Please verify your plugins against the reconciled settings rather than cached copies. The corrected production configuration is reproduced below for reference.

settings of tagef-bawif:
DRUIX_HOST=druix.zemvarlabs.internal
DRUIX_PORT=8000

Previously the job loaded every SKU delta into memory, which fell over once the Copperfield depot came online. It now streams deltas in batches, retries transient mismatches, and quarantines records that fail three passes instead of aborting the run. Future maintainers: the batch and retry values were chosen after profiling against the Halverton dataset, so don't tweak them casually without rerunning that benchmark. The tuning constants used by the job are listed below.

tuning constants:
WEIGHTS = {
    "kasion": 449,
    "julax": 314,
    "novdor": 823,
    "ralmir": 390,
    "novael": 220,
}

**Ticket: Nightly backfill scheduler skips partitions after DST-adjacent window**

For the weekly sync: the Corvatch scheduler silently skipped three partitions of the Lanthorn warehouse backfill last night. Root cause appears to be the window calculator truncating to local midnight rather than UTC, so any partition whose boundary falls in the adjusted hour is dropped without an error. Proposed fix: normalize all window math to UTC and add an invariant check. The skip was first observed under the following build.

build token for yahof-bahip: htk14_723f61764e90eb